当前位置:网站首页 > 新媒体 > 正文

mysql中文乱码解决方法(mysql中文显示乱码的原因)

0 李勇seo 李勇seo 2025-05-01 11:04 3

场景说明:

mysql8安装默认库编码为 utf8mb4。新建数据库编码为 utf8 +utf8_general_ci。win10使用navicat客户端连接,新建的表字段注释中文乱码,但是表的注释中文显示正常,内容中文显示正常。

根据网上的各种设置编码方式均无效。

最后发现解决方案:

1.查看系统本身的编码,打开命令行输入chcp

Navicat for MySQL字段注释中文乱码

如果Active code page(活动代码页)值不是65001(UTF8),而是其他比如936(GBK)

注:这个就是我这个场景的根本原因,现在要做的就是把值设为65001

Navicat for MySQL字段注释中文乱码
Navicat for MySQL字段注释中文乱码
Navicat for MySQL字段注释中文乱码
Navicat for MySQL字段注释中文乱码

确定后,系统会自动重启。再次打开navicat,表中字段备注显示正常。

李勇seo

李勇seo

TA很懒,啥都没写...

本文暂时没有评论,来添加一个吧(●'◡'●)

取消回复欢迎 发表评论:

@百闻站长 本站部分内容转自互联网,若有侵权等问题请及时与本站联系,我们将在第一时间删除处理。 | 粤ICP备2025402138号 | (地图